Solid control system for drilling fluid is one of main petroleum drilling equipments. As the increasing drilling quality is required in the modern drilling technology, the quality of purifying drilling fluid influences directly drilling quality and cost, and solid control system for drilling fluid with good quality in drilling engineering is necessary. Solid control system is equipped with various models and level purifying devices including vibrating screen, sand separator, sludge remover, centrifuge, vertiginous mixer and shear pump, etc according to drilling requirement, which is used to circulate and purify drilling fluid to make sure that the parameters including density and viscosity meet the requirements of drilling technology.Based on requirements and development features of drilling technology in Daqing, solid control system for drilling fluid satisfying various requirements of solid control technology is designed and developed. It meets the requirements for drilling fluid in drilling technology completely, and optimizes configuration of solid control purifying device for drilling fluid, avoiding wasting and insufficient configuration and improving equipment level of solid control system for drilling fluid.Aiming at requirements of solid control system for drilling fluid in Daqing, advantages and disadvantages of available solid control system are analyzed. Advanced solid control system for drilling fluid fit for production requirements is developed, combined with drilling technology flow and requirements in Daqing. Operating principle, purifying efficiency and serviceable range of solid control device at home and abroad are compared. Parameters are calculated based on specific requirements of solid control flow and the solid control device is chosen to achieve the best matching effect. Structure, circuitry system and auxiliary tools of solid control system are computed to meet features including reasonable structural design, reliable and safe operation. The solid control system flow for drilling fluid is optimized, and consequently have many technology flows including circulating drilling fluid, adding weight and drug, supply, etc with reasonable pipe layout, convenient adjustment, improving the solid control effect for drilling fluid greatly. On the basis of solid control devices are applied, i.e. entire matching ability of vibrating screen, sand separator, sludge remover, centrifuge, vertiginous mixer and shear pump is studied, achieving the best result. The critical devices are researched systematically and computed reasonably based on actual drilling fluid, making the capability of solid control device satisfy the requirement of modern drilling engineering.
